菜鸟笔记
提升您的技术认知

菜鸟教程-ag真人官方网

cpu密集型 io密集型

菜鸟阅读 : 2314

cpu密集型(cpu-bound) cpu密集型线程的作用是进行无阻塞的逻辑运算的线程。比如:rpg游戏中的游戏逻辑服务器(也叫地图服务器)里面的主逻辑线程,这个主逻辑线程需要进行大量的无阻塞的逻辑处理。当被操作系统内核调度的时候,这个线程...

javascript与jscript的区别

菜鸟阅读 : 2845

javascript与jscript的区别 前言:很多人无法区别javascript和jscript,或者根本就不去区分他们,这是不对的. 什么是jscript? jscript是微软公司对ecma-262语言规范的一种实现,除了少数例外(...

linux root用户与一般用户的区别

菜鸟阅读 : 2859

root用户可以在linux系统上做任何操作,权限没有收到任何限制。一般需要root权限的任务包括:移动文件或者文件夹in或者out of 系统目录,复制文件到系统目录,赋予或者收回用户权限,系统维护和安装一些应用程序,例如:安装rpm格式...

取物必胜策略

菜鸟阅读 : 2518

两个人取石头 每次最少1个,最多a个,共有n个 考虑倍数问题 int f = n % (a 1); 我先拿f个,然后之后的每次你取x个,我就取(a 1)-x个,我必赢   例如: 100个球两个人每次最多取五个最少取一个,谁能拿到...

打印二叉树的方法

菜鸟阅读 : 1575

层序遍历 之前学到层序遍历的方法,分组打印每一层,但是效果似乎不是很好。因为还需要自己判断 //层序遍历分组输出 vector >levelgroup(treenode* root) { q...

单链表的创建(有头结点和无头结点)

菜鸟阅读 : 2681

前言 在学链表的时候,对链表创建的过程一知半解。目前现在刷题的阶段,发现这部分很重要,所以这次完全解决这个知识点。   1 带头结点的链表 为了方便,创建带有10个结点的链表,链表的数据域为整数类型,取随机整数。链表结构如下图: ...

最优化算法之粒子群算法(pso)

菜鸟阅读 : 2287

一、粒子群算法的概念   粒子群优化算法(pso:particle swarm optimization) 是一种进化计算技术(evolutionary computation)。源于对鸟群捕食的行为研究。粒子群优化算法的基本思想:是通过群...

三分钟弄懂线程池执行过程

菜鸟阅读 : 1268

线程池是如何运转的我一直不清楚,今天来根据源码梳理下。 线程池任务提交与运行 直接看结果,主流程如下: 线程池调用execute提交任务—>创建worker(设置属性thead、firsttask)—>worker.thread...

网站地图